Is the JAR etc that contains org.jboss.system.server.ServerImpl on the
source lookup path as specified on the Source tab of your Java application
launch configuration?

> My Problem:
> ============
> When I launch the application in the debugger with a breakpoint in
> org.jboss.Main.main(), Eclipse displays the source file and I can debug
> normally, single-stepping, etc. I can single-step up to the method:
> org.jboss.Main.boot(), at the line, "server.init(props)".
>
> When I step into server.init() in the debugger, the source file for
> org.jboss.system.server.ServerImpl is not found by the debugger, even
> though I can open that file in the Java perspective or the Plugin
> Perspective and view/edit the source.
>
> Question:
> =========
>
> Why is the org.jboss.system.server.ServerImpl source file not found by
> the Eclipse debugger?
